Firefighters from Company’s 1 and 2 teamed up this month for a large scale water supply drill at our Dive Pond in North Carver. Officers focused on basic water supply, designing a water shuttle with Engine 1 as a supply Engine, and Tanker 1 and Brush Breaker 27 on a continuous loop to keep Engine 2’s master stream, and a for the most part, a blitz fire gun flowing water. Also incorporated into the evolution was some hands on training with our float pumps that are carried on each brush breaker and an overview of Forestry 25. Near the end of the drill a wrench was thrown in as Company’s 1 and 3 were dispatched to an MVA with Entrapment on South Meadow Road, in our center district. (Photo’s by Retired Chief Bill Harriman)
